Like the Blue Jays had to deal with in 2020, the Raptors can’t stage their home games in Toronto to start the next NBA season.

As COVID-19 is still a thing, the US-Canada border is closed for unessential travel and that includes professional sports.

As we know, the Toronto Blue Jays were denied the ability to play their home games at the Rogers Centre for the 2020 season, which forced them to relocate to Buffalo.

Four months later, the Toronto Raptors were attempting to put together a plan to have their own home games at the Scotiabank Arena. Yesterday, it was revealed that the Raptors received the same answer and got the same fate as the Blue Jays in which the federal government denied them the ability to play in Toronto. The Raptors will be relocating to Tampa, but the hope is that it will only be temporary and just for the start of the NBA season.

The Raptors getting the red light to play their games in Canada is bad news for the Blue Jays hopes of having home games north of the border for the 2021 season, but the team and fans should remain optimistic.

One, baseball season is still months away. The Blue Jays home opener isn’t slated until April 8th as their first two series of the season are on the road in New York and Texas respectively. As the Canadian government made a decision on where they could play in 2020 last minute, this could give the Blue Jays more time to prepare for potentially hosting games in Toronto.

While no one knows the future, cases could potentially go down among residents in Ontario in the next little while. Right now though, cases are only rising, and the Toronto and Peel Region are entering another lockdown starting Monday.

Two, there is a hotel attached right to the Rogers Centre. The Marriot City Centre Hotel is on the outside looking in as can be seen in right centre field. Opposing teams can stay at that hotel, in which there is a path that connects from the hotel right to the ballpark. How it can work is that as soon as opposing teams land in Toronto, they get right off the plane onto a bus and into the hotel. This way, they wouldn’t be exposed to the public, and they likely wouldn’t be allowed to leave the hotel or stadium premises.

It should be noted though that this was a part of the plan the team presented to the government which was denied.
